Analysis

In 2024, mother-to-child hiv transmission rate in Guinea-Bissau stood at 17.9.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 23.2% on the previous year and up 73.8% over ten years.

Over the whole period, mother-to-child hiv transmission rate in Guinea-Bissau peaked at 37.2 in 2010 and was at its lowest, 10.3, in 2014.

Guinea-Bissau ranks 33rd of 81 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

Mother-to-child HIV transmission rate in Guinea-Bissau, year by year

Annual values for Mother-to-child HIV transmission rate in Guinea-Bissau, 2010 to 2024.
Year Value Change
2010 37.2
2011 33.7 -9.4%
2012 29 -13.9%
2013 22.5 -22.4%
2014 10.3 -54.2%
2015 13.3 +29.1%
2016 18.7 +40.6%
2017 18.4 -1.6%
2018 23.5 +27.7%
2019 19.7 -16.2%
2020 19 -3.6%
2021 24.2 +27.4%
2022 23.3 -3.7%
2023 23.3 +0.0%
2024 17.9 -23.2%
